Dear Community,

Most of you know that OpenMoko is a fully independent company at  
this point. With this great opportunity comes many challenges.  
Today I would like to share one with you all and ask for some advice.


We need to file patents for our hardware as well as software  
designs. While my personal views on software patents are inline  
with people like Eben Moglen, as a company, we are forced to play  
by the rules of the game.


What I want is for a our company's patents to be freely available,  
for anyone, but for defensive purposes only.


Are there any existing options available to us now? Does anyone  
know of existing companies or organizations with a similar strategy  
that we can seek guidance or partnership.


Again, I want to emphasize that we only want our patents to be used  
in defense. And what constitutes defense is something that we want  
to be able to define (and potentially even redefine when new  
threats arise).


Thanks in advance for the help.
